When flying with the countermeasures pod, the quick release works for me (the one with the switch on the throttle), but none of the fancier modes seem to. I.e., setting the pod mode selector to 3 and the KB release switch on the canopy to continuous neither releases chaff in external view, nor sets off the MOTVERK light on the right-side indicator panel. Is this expected behavior for now, or am I doing something wrong?

1. Are you using keys to control that switch on the canopy? Because it doesn't work with clicks. Only key-presses. I have one button to set the switch to KONT (continuous) and one to put the switch back into the neutral position (ceases all dispensing unless you're using quick release).

 

2. Are you making sure the streak selector (dial next to the countermeasure mode selector), is set to "0" instead of "4"?
